BILL NUMBER: S5665
SPONSOR: CLEARE
 
TITLE OF BILL:
An act to amend the public health law, in relation to establishing a
doula awareness and education program
 
PURPOSE OR GENERAL IDEA OF BILL::
Facilitates the creation of an ongoing public awareness and education
program on doulas and how beneficial they are to pregnancies.
 
SUMMARY OF PROVISIONS::
The state law is amended by adding a new section 207-B to article 2 to
increase awareness on doulas.
 
JUSTIFICATION::
Maternal mortality has been a persistent issue that has plagued our
country. Unfortunately, in the United States racial disparities have
reinforced inequitable access to proper maternal care. This along with
other factors such as the community, facility, patient, and provider has
led to an increase in maternal deaths amongst Black women. A doula is a
trained professional who provides emotional, physical, and enlightening
support during pregnancy, delivery, and birth. They can help decrease
the maternal mortality rate especially for women with higher risk preg-
nancies.
By establishing a doula awareness and education program more people will
be informed about what a doula is and how beneficial they can be to a
pregnancy. There are often gaps when providing individualized attention
to parents during labor. A doula can fill this gap by providing contin-
uous and personalized support to ensure the safety of the birthgiver.
The birth of a child is something so beautiful - something a parent
should not have to lose their life for. By increasing awareness of
doulas and how they can improve pregnancy we can be saving lives that do
not need to be lost.
